Worm compost, also known as vermicompost, is a type of compost produced with the help of worms. It involves the process of utilizing worms, typically red wigglers, to break down organic waste materials such as kitchen scraps, garden waste, and paper into nutrient-rich compost. The worms consume the waste, digest it, and excrete castings, which are nutrient-dense organic matter. Worm composting is an efficient and environmentally-friendly method of recycling organic waste, producing a high-quality fertilizer that can be used to enrich soil, improve plant growth, and enhance soil health. It is commonly used in gardening, agriculture, and horticulture practices.
